tl;dr
The
strict-dynamic
source list keyword allows you to simplify your CSP policy by favoring hashes and nonces over domain host lists.The key super power of
strict-dynamic
is that it will allow to load additional scripts via non-"parser-inserted" script elements.
For unsupported browsers Show archive.org snapshot , your script can be made backwards compatible by doing something like this:
script-src 'nonce-rAnd0m' 'strict-dynamic' https: 'self'
default-src 'self';
